“If we are to live up to our highest ideals, Brandeis University and Brandeis International Business School must strive to be a beacon of hope in times of despair,” said Alan Hassenfeld, H’20, retired chairman and CEO of Hasbro. “The Peace Scholarship Fund will allow us to open our doors to students from Ukraine who are forced to flee their homes and need a safe, welcoming place to pursue an education.”
In response to the war in Ukraine and the many other conflicts occurring in regions across the world, Brandeis International Business School is excited to offer the Peace Scholarship. The scholarship provides full tuition to new master’s degree and aims to support students who have been displaced from and forced to leave their country due to violent conflict or persecution for reasons of race, religion, nationality, or membership of a particular social group, or political opinion.
The first Peace Scholar, an MBA student from Ukraine, began her studies at the International Business School this semester. The School hopes to raise a total of $1 million for the Peace Scholarship which would provide funding for up to 10 students to study at Brandeis.
Alumni and friends can help us continue to increase the funds available to students who seek to continue their education in the United States despite conflict at home. As Brandeis President Ron Liebowitz has stated, “Brandeis was founded by the American Jewish Community, many of whom had either fled Europe or lost whole families in World War II. Helping those who face similar threats to their lives is something we feel a strong obligation to do.” Learn more about the Peace Scholarship.
